Advantages of Oral Implants
Lots of elders discover that oral implants use a life-changing solution for missing teeth. Unlike dentures, which can move and trigger discomfort, dental implants provide a secure and protected choice. You can consume your favorite foods without bothering with your teeth slipping or relocating. This newly found self-confidence can boost your overall quality of life.
Another significant benefit is the natural look of dental implants. They're designed to mix perfectly with your existing teeth, enabling you to smile easily without feeling self-conscious.
Plus, they help preserve your jawbone thickness. When you shed teeth, the bone can begin to degrade, however implants stimulate the bone, preventing further loss and helping protect your facial framework.
Additionally, oral implants require less upkeep than dentures. You will not need to eliminate them for cleaning; just brush and floss as you generally would. This simplicity of care can be a significant advantage for seniors.
Factors to consider for Senior citizens
While dental implants offer countless advantages, there are necessary factors to consider seniors ought to bear in mind before waging this alternative.
Initially, your total health plays a vital role. Problems like diabetic issues, osteoporosis, or heart concerns can impact recovery and make complex the treatment. It's vital to talk to your doctor to ensure you're an appropriate prospect.
Next, take into consideration the expense. Oral implants can be pricey, and insurance protection varies. See to it you understand your monetary duties and discover payment alternatives if required.
Furthermore, consider your oral health routine. Implants need attentive care to protect against infection and make certain long life.
Another aspect is the time dedication entailed. The process can take several months from assessment to last positioning, so you'll require to prepare accordingly.

The Implant Procedure Process
Recognizing the dental implant procedure process is important for senior citizens considering this oral option. The trip typically begins with an examination where your dentist examines your dental health and wellness and discusses your objectives. They might take X-rays or scans to guarantee you're a suitable candidate for implants.
When you're authorized, the initial step of the treatment entails putting the titanium implant right into your jawbone. This is done under local anesthesia, so you won't really feel discomfort during the process.
After the dental implant is positioned, it's essential to allow a recovery duration of a few months. During this moment, the implant integrates with your bone-- a procedure referred to as osseointegration.
After healing, you'll go back to the dental practitioner to connect a joint, which works as a connector in between the implant and the crown. As soon as the abutment is protected, impressions of your mouth will certainly be required to develop a personalized crown that matches your all-natural teeth.
Ultimately, when your crown is ready, your dentist will connect it to the abutment. The entire procedure may take several months, yet the outcome is a durable, natural-looking tooth that can significantly enhance your lifestyle.
